My recent experience with purchasing an apartment through 1Partner Ehitus OÜ was disappointing and worrying. Below I would like to highlight some important points that negatively affected the apartment purchasing process for me and my family: 1. **Uncertainty on the website**: When choosing an apartment, I relied heavily on the information provided on the 1Partner Ehitus OÜ website. However, it later turned out that this information was misleading and did not correspond to reality. The website promised high-quality concrete surfaces, but in reality they turned out to be below expectations. 2. **Lack of communication**: From the first day I contacted the broker, I had technical questions and concerns that I expected to be resolved professionally. Unfortunately, I did not receive sufficient explanations or support from 1Partner Ehitus OÜ, especially regarding the finishing of the apartment. 3. **Quality difference**: During the inspection and beforehand, it was clear that the concrete surfaces of the apartment did not meet the "A" standard (BÜ4, 2010) - they had dirt, casting defects and wood residues from the plywood formwork. It was surprising that my comments and the consultant's comments on this were not recorded or taken into account. The builder refused to acknowledge the presence of these deficiencies. 4. **Incomplete inspection report**: Having participated in a repeated inspection, I did not have access to the official inspection report, which would have recorded the results of today's inspection. This deficiency prevented my ability to see how the noted deficiencies were being corrected and what the deadlines were. The report was later submitted, but without the buyer's comments. 5. **Refusal of improvements**: When I presented a solution to resolve the issue that the builder would paint the concrete surfaces white to meet the required quality class 2 according to the "Interior Works RYL 2013 and Painting Works RYL 2012", 1Partner Ehitus OÜ refused this solution and did not accept responsibility for correcting the deficiencies. This entire experience with 1Partner Ehitus OÜ was disappointing and showed their lack of customer service and willingness to resolve any issues that arose. I was hoping for better service and a better apartment, but I am disappointed with both the service and the quality of the apartment.
